PHOTOS: 2012 Monterey Jazz Festival

A huge lineup of jazz greats played a huge amount of great sets at the 55th annual Monterey Jazz Festival this weekend.

Singer Tony Bennett brought his classic sound on Saturday night following a funky trio set by guitarist Pat Metheny, bassist Christian McBride and drummer Jack DeJohnette.

DeJohnette would also play a killer, improvised set with Bill Frisell on Sunday in Dizzy's Den. It was wild and jazz fans know DeJohnette's weird drumming from the avant-garde Miles Davis classic album "Bitches Brew."

Daytime sets on the main stage saw sizzling performances by Trombone Shorty on Saturday and bass player Esperanza Spalding on Sunday.
